How they compare
Cape Verde currently reports 1.1 GPIA against 1.1 GPIA in Tunisia, a difference of 0 GPIA.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Cape Verde ahead.
Cape Verde ranks 33rd and Tunisia ranks 35th of 179 countries.
Cape Verde has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cape Verde |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.06 GPIA | 1.05 GPIA | 0.0114 GPIA | Cape Verde |
| 2010s | 1.09 GPIA | 1.08 GPIA | 0.0164 GPIA | Cape Verde |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
